Stairs

Bunk beds with stairs or ladders can be an enjoyable way to add extra sleeping space to kids' rooms. When looking for bunk beds that have stairs, think about the sort of room layout you want to create. You might want to determine the dimensions of your child's bedroom to ensure that any new bunk bed can fit comfortably without blocking doors, windows or furniture already in the space. Stairs must be secure and sturdy and securely attached to the bed frame. This will stop them from moving as kids climb up and down.

A slide can be added to bunk beds to add enjoyment to the space. Slides are a great way for kids to play with their friends, and they can be removed as they get older. Stairs with built-in drawers can be another option worth considering, as they can help keep the space clean and organized for children as well as parents.

Ladders

A ladder is an upright structure that can be used to climb up and down. Examples include ladders in swimming pools, on the top of a bunk bed, or even on fire engines. A ladder can be fixed into place or it may retract when not in use, like a rope ladder that pulls up or down on a pole.

Regardless of which type of ladder you decide to make for your bunk bed, it's vital that it be constructed properly. You don't want your child to fall or get hurt. To ensure your ladder is safe, construct it from wood that's thick enough to withstand the weight of a person. Also, space the rungs of the ladder at minimum 10 inches apart. To prevent accidents, it is best to place the rungs a bit further apart with children.

If you're creating a bunk set which will be used by children aged 6 and over It's a good idea to consider using stairs instead of ladders for the upper bunk. Stairs come with a handrail for kids to grasp onto while climbing up to the bed. This makes them more secure than ladders. Plus, kids of all ages are able to navigate stairs with ease than a ladder.

Bunk beds with stairs look better than those that have ladders. They're typically constructed from solid wood and have a stunning finish that can match any bedroom decor. The stairs can be painted or stained to match the design of the bunk beds. They can also be secured with several thin coats of polyurethane to keep the wooden surface looking nice and to prevent the possibility of splinters.

If you are planning to stain your ladder-stairs first, apply a primer to help the color adhere. Then, follow the product's instructions on application and drying time. If you're considering painting your ladder-stairs, you should prime them first too before applying the base coat. Finally, you can add one or two coats of color. If you're looking for a more natural look, skip the painting and finish the wood with a few coats of polyurethane.
